IOTA - 233 belongs to the category of hydrogen - terminated T - type phenyl polysiloxane, with a molecular weight range of 550 - 3000. This unique molecular structure endows it with many excellent characteristics. It appears as a colorless, transparent, and viscous liquid, with a pure and aesthetically pleasing appearance. Its specific gravity ranges from 1.00 to 1.01, and its refractive index at 20℃ is between 1.46 and 1.52. These physical parameters make it perform well in optics and material appearance. Additionally, its viscosity at 25℃ is in the range of 5 - 5000 mm²/s, allowing for flexible selection according to different application requirements. The flash point is greater than 110℃, ensuring safety during storage and use. The hydrogen content (H%) is between 0.35 and 0.75, providing a guarantee for the stability of product performance.
IOTA - 233 has good compatibility with methyl silicone oil, liquid silicone rubber, phenyl silicone rubber, and phenyl silicone resin. This means that in practical applications, it can be easily mixed with these materials to form a homogeneous system. This compatibility lays a solid foundation for its use in addition - type silicone rubber, phenyl silicone rubber, and phenyl silicone resin. For example, in the preparation process of addition - type silicone rubber, IOTA - 233 can act as a cross - linking agent, working synergistically with other components to improve the performance of silicone rubber, such as better flexibility, elasticity, and aging resistance.
Due to its unique properties and good compatibility, IOTA - 233 has broad application prospects in multiple fields. In the electronics and electrical field, it can be used to manufacture high - performance sealing materials and insulating materials to protect electronic components from the influence of the external environment. In the automotive manufacturing field, it can be applied to the sealing and bonding of automotive parts, improving the sealing and reliability of automobiles. In the aerospace field, its excellent properties can meet the high requirements of aerospace equipment for materials, contributing to the development of the aerospace industry.
